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 09/11] crypto: blake2s - share the "shash" API boilerplate code
Date: Sat, 19 Dec 2020 01:01:53 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<CAHmME9pAEssKZGUchD6kh=waNnUcK=MOW2-=9Qv0Tsec4=0xgQ@mail.g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<X90MPh/uwXXu3F/Y@sol.localdomain>

Hey Eric,

The solution you've proposed at the end of your email is actually kind
of similar to what we do with curve25519. Check out
include/crypto/curve25519.h. The critical difference between that and
the blake proposal is that it's in the header for curve25519, so the
indirection disappears.

Could we do that with headers for blake?

Jason
